Wildlife photography is a captivating way to connect with nature and showcase the beauty of animals in their natural habitats. To truly encapsulate the essence of wildlife, it is essential to understand their behavior and environment. Research the animals you wish to photograph, noting their routines and the best times for sightings. Consider visiting during the golden hours of early morning or late afternoon when the light is soft and warm, enhancing the overall aesthetic of your images.
Moreover, mastering your equipment is crucial for capturing those fleeting moments. Use a telephoto lens to maintain distance without startling the subject, and ensure your settings can adapt to changing light conditions. Patience and stealth are key components; spend time in the field observing rather than just shooting, and be ready to capture the spontaneous interactions of wildlife. Remember, the goal is to portray the natural essence of the animal in its environment, creating compelling images that tell a story.
Nature photography plays a vital role in conservation efforts by raising awareness and promoting a deeper connection to the environment. Through stunning visuals, photographers capture the beauty and fragility of ecosystems, showcasing the diverse flora and fauna that inhabit our planet. These images can invoke emotional responses, inspiring individuals and communities to appreciate the natural world and consider the impact of their actions. By highlighting endangered species and threatened habitats, nature photography serves as a powerful tool to educate the public about the challenges facing our environment.
Moreover, nature photography not only brings attention to conservation issues but also supports various initiatives. Many organizations use captivating images to engage with their audiences, generate support, and fundraise for their conservation projects. This visual storytelling can effectively communicate the urgency for action, driving grassroots movements and influencing policy changes. In summary, the impact of nature photography extends beyond aesthetics; it is a crucial component in fostering a culture of conservation, motivating people to take action, and protecting our planet for future generations.
